WebMar 24, 2024 · Periyar (1879–1973) was the founder of the Self-Respect Movement in Tamil Nadu, a key figure of Dravidian politics, and leader of the pressure group Dravidar Kazhagam. He is known most for his atheism and radical critique of religion 1 and also for his commitment and contribution to anti-caste thought and politics 2. WebResigning the Chairmanship of Erode Municipality, Periyar enrolled himself as member of that Congress party. 1920 He ardently participated in the NonCo-operation movement launched against the British rule by ‘Mahatma’ Gandhi. On the latter’s clarion call, Periyar resigned all the 29 public positions held by him.
